Output 55fc6f2d30e392995febbdffdf0614a66e819f266cd5b71d69a14b151bb1ea77:4

value
4504182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bd5a5bcc0645bf65ce31620caed8edfeab894ca OP_EQUAL
address
3A4bMUx5EsYCya8Sjcsoq2VbwYx2XAiRE5
transaction
55fc6f2d30e392995febbdffdf0614a66e819f266cd5b71d69a14b151bb1ea77
confirmations
227409
spent
true